What to tell the garage about P0178

Do not drive. The fuel-composition sensor circuit is sitting lower than the computer allows. That points at wiring, earth or a weak sender output — not at a mixture that is already too rich.

What does P0178 mean?

P0178 is a generic (SAE standard) powertrain code reported by your car’s engine control unit. It sits in the P01xx block, which covers fuel and air metering. The stored description is “Fuel Composition Sensor Circuit Low”. The code itself tells you which circuit or system tripped the fault — not always the exact part that failed.

Will P0178 fail an MOT?

An illuminated engine management light is a Major defect at MOT (automatic fail) until the fault is repaired and the light stays off.
